## Understanding the Anatomy and Physiology of the Bearded Dragon

The bearded dragon (*Pogona vitticeps*) is a semi-arboreal lizard native to the arid and semi-arid regions of inland Australia [<a href="#ref-1">1</a>]. As an Agamid lizard, it is an ectotherm, meaning it relies on external heat sources to regulate its body temperature and metabolic processes. Their skin is covered in specialized scales called scutes, which are thickened, keeled scales. In healthy dragons, these scutes lie relatively flat. When a dragon develops pyramiding, these scutes grow upward in a cone-like fashion.

The health of these scales is directly tied to the lizard's overall systemic health, particularly its bone metabolism. The skin and skeleton are linked by shared nutritional and hormonal pathways. A deficiency in calcium, vitamin D3, or an imbalance in phosphorus leads to a cascade of problems. The body attempts to maintain normal blood calcium levels by pulling calcium from the bones, leading to softening (fibrous osteodystrophy) and deformities. The skin's response to this metabolic stress is abnormal keratin production, resulting in the hard, raised bumps characteristic of pyramiding.

Proper husbandry is the foundation of health. This includes providing a thermal gradient so the lizard can bask at its preferred body temperature to digest food and absorb nutrients. The postprandial (after-eating) metabolic state is a critical consideration in this species. A 2024 study on the prandial effects of a semielemental diet in bearded dragons found significant increases in plasma uric acid, bile acids, and glucose after feeding [<a href="#ref-2">2</a>]. This highlights how diet and feeding schedules directly impact the lizard's internal medicine and must be considered when interpreting bloodwork. For instance, a blood test showing high uric acid could be a normal post-feeding fluctuation, not necessarily a sign of kidney failure [<a href="#ref-2">2</a>]. This is a key reason why a veterinarian must interpret diagnostics in the context of the animal's history and feeding status.

## What is Pyramiding? A Sign of Metabolic Bone Disease

Pyramiding is the clinical manifestation of severe, long-term calcium and vitamin D3 deficiency, a complex known as Metabolic Bone Disease (MBD). While MBD can be caused by renal disease or other internal issues, in pet bearded dragons it is overwhelmingly a husbandry-induced disease.

The condition begins with a dietary imbalance. Bearded dragons require a specific ratio of calcium to phosphorus in their diet, ideally around 1.5:1 to 2:1. Many feeder insects, such as crickets and mealworms, have a poor calcium-to-phosphorus ratio, being high in phosphorus. Phosphorus binds to calcium in the gut, preventing its absorption. If the dragon's diet is high in phosphorus and low in calcium, the body's blood calcium levels will drop.

To survive, the parathyroid gland releases parathyroid hormone (PTH). PTH stimulates the breakdown of bone to release calcium into the bloodstream. Over time, this demineralization weakens the bones, causing them to become soft and pliable. The bones of the jaw, spine, and legs are most affected. The skin overlying these weakened bones, particularly where there is mechanical stress, responds by producing excess keratin, leading to the raised, pyramidal scutes.

This condition is not just a cosmetic issue. It is a painful, systemic disease. It can lead to:
- Pathological fractures of the spine and legs.
- Muscle weakness and an inability to walk or climb.
- Paralysis due to spinal compression.
- Egg-binding (dystocia) in females.
- Seizures and tremors due to low blood calcium (hypocalcemia).
- Anorexia and lethargy.

## Primary Causes and Risk Factors

The development of pyramiding is multifactorial, but the primary risk factors are clear.

### Inadequate UVB Lighting
This is the most common cause. Bearded dragons require exposure to UVB light (wavelengths 290-315 nm) to synthesize vitamin D3 in their skin. Vitamin D3 is essential for the absorption of calcium from the gut. Without UVB, a dragon cannot absorb calcium, no matter how much is in its diet. Many commercial bulbs do not emit adequate UVB, or they lose their potency over time. The bulb must be a specific type (not a regular basking bulb), placed at the correct distance from the lizard, and replaced every 6-12 months as recommended by the manufacturer. The light must be unobstructed by glass or plastic, which filters out UVB rays.

### Nutritional Imbalances
- **High Phosphorus Diet:** Feeding a diet consisting primarily of insects like mealworms or superworms, which are high in phosphorus, is a major risk factor.
- **Calcium Deficiency:** Not dusting insects with a calcium supplement or not providing a calcium-rich salad can lead to deficiency.
- **Vitamin D3 Deficiency:** Even with UVB, some dragons with liver or kidney disease cannot convert vitamin D3 to its active form. However, this is less common than simple husbandry failure.

### Inadequate Temperature Gradient
Bearded dragons need a basking spot of 95-110°F (35-43°C) and a cool side of 75-85°F (24-29°C). If the environment is too cold, the lizard's metabolism slows down. It cannot properly digest food, which impairs nutrient absorption, including calcium and fat-soluble vitamins.

### High Protein Diet
While the exact mechanism is debated, feeding a diet excessively high in protein, especially to juveniles, is thought to contribute to rapid growth that outpaces calcium deposition in bones, increasing the risk of deformities like pyramiding.

### Genetics and Individual Variation
Some dragons are simply more genetically predisposed to developing pyramiding than others, even under identical husbandry. This is an area of ongoing research.

## Veterinary Examination and Diagnostics

If you suspect your bearded dragon has pyramiding or any other health issue, a prompt visit to a veterinarian experienced with reptiles is essential. The veterinarian will perform a thorough physical examination, which is invaluable in identifying disease in these stoic animals [<a href="#ref-1">1</a>].

The diagnostic workup may include:

1.  **Physical Examination:** The vet will assess the lizard's body condition, muscle mass, and posture. They will palpate the bones to check for swelling, fractures, or pain. The oral cavity will be examined for a soft, rubbery jaw (a sign of advanced MBD).

2.  **Radiography (X-rays):** This is a critical diagnostic tool. X-rays can reveal:
    - Decreased bone density (osteopenia).
    - Pathological fractures of the spine or long bones.
    - Abnormal bone shape and structure.
    - The presence of a "pathologic" fracture that could explain a sudden lameness.

3.  **Bloodwork (Clinical Pathology):** Blood tests are essential to assess the internal health of the dragon and to rule out other causes of illness. A complete blood count (CBC) and a plasma biochemistry panel are recommended.
    - **Calcium and Phosphorus:** The vet will look at total calcium and phosphorus levels. An imbalance (low calcium, high phosphorus) is a strong indicator of MBD.
    - **Uric Acid:** This is a waste product from protein metabolism. High levels can indicate kidney disease, which can also cause calcium imbalances. However, as noted in a 2024 study, uric acid levels can rise significantly after a meal, so the vet will need to know the fasting status of the patient [<a href="#ref-2">2</a>].
    - **Bile Acids:** This test assesses liver function. The same study showed bile acids can increase significantly 24 hours after feeding, so this test should be interpreted with feeding history in mind [<a href="#ref-2">2</a>].
    - **Glucose:** Blood glucose levels can also be affected by recent feeding, with significant increases seen postprandially [<a href="#ref-2">2</a>].
    - **Albumin and Protein:** A 2021 study comparing methods for measuring albumin in bearded dragons found that the standard bromocresol green (BCG) dye-binding method consistently overestimates albumin compared to protein electrophoresis [<a href="#ref-3">3</a>]. This is a crucial detail; your veterinarian should use species-appropriate methods to interpret protein levels accurately. This is especially important for assessing nutritional status and chronic disease.

4.  **Tissue Enzyme Activities:** The vet may also interpret plasma enzyme activities. A 2024 study characterized the tissue activities of several enzymes in bearded dragons [<a href="#ref-4">4</a>]. For example, creatinine kinase (CK) is highest in skeletal muscle, while ALT and AST are relatively non-specific. This information helps the vet determine if elevated enzymes are from muscle damage, liver issues, or other sources. The study also noted that hepatic fat accumulation can reduce AST activity on a weight-per-weight basis, which can complicate interpretation in obese dragons [<a href="#ref-4">4</a>].

## Evidence-Based Management and Treatment

There is no cure for pyramiding; the physical deformities are permanent. However, treatment is aimed at halting the progression of MBD, managing pain, and correcting the underlying husbandry issues. Treatment must be guided by a veterinarian, as the specific protocol depends on the severity of the disease and the results of bloodwork.

The cornerstone of treatment is **husbandry correction**:
- **UVB Lighting:** Replace the UVB bulb with a new, high-quality bulb designed for desert reptiles. Ensure it is placed at the correct distance (usually 6-12 inches from the basking spot, depending on the bulb) and is not blocked by glass or plastic.
- **Calcium Supplementation:** The vet may recommend a liquid or powdered calcium supplement (e.g., calcium glubionate) to be given orally. This is often done daily or several times a week, depending on the severity of the hypocalcemia.
- **Dietary Correction:** The diet must be rebalanced. This involves:
    - Reducing or eliminating high-phosphorus insects like mealworms.
    - Increasing the proportion of dark, leafy greens (e.g., collard greens, mustard greens, dandelion greens) which are high in calcium.
    - Dusting insects with a calcium supplement (without vitamin D3 if the dragon has adequate UVB, or with vitamin D3 if there are concerns about synthesis).
- **Thermal Gradient:** Ensure the basking spot and cool side temperatures are correct to allow for proper digestion and metabolism.

**Medical Management:**
- **Pain Relief:** MBD is painful. Your veterinarian may prescribe pain medication (analgesics) to improve the lizard's comfort and quality of life.
- **Fluid Therapy:** If the dragon is dehydrated or anorexic, subcutaneous or oral fluids may be administered.
- **Nutritional Support:** In cases of severe anorexia, a critical care diet may be recommended. A 2024 study on a semielemental critical-care diet showed it can be used to provide nutrition, but it has significant effects on bloodwork (increasing uric acid, bile acids, and glucose) that must be monitored [<a href="#ref-2">2</a>].
- **Treatment of Underlying Conditions:** If the MBD is secondary to another disease, such as kidney failure or liver disease, that condition must be addressed. For example, a dragon with a bacterial infection like pneumonia may require specific antimicrobial therapy [<a href="#ref-5">5</a>]. In that case report, a dragon with pneumonia and a concurrent adenovirus and Mycoplasma infection did not survive despite treatment, highlighting the importance of early and aggressive diagnosis [<a href="#ref-5">5</a>].

## Unsafe Home Remedies and What to Avoid

It is critical to avoid well-intentioned but harmful home remedies.

- **Do NOT give oral vitamin D3 without veterinary supervision.** While vitamin D3 is necessary, too much can cause vitamin D toxicity, leading to calcification of soft tissues like the kidneys and blood vessels.
- **Do NOT attempt to "file down" or "sand" the pyramided scales.** This is painful and will cause trauma and infection.
- **Do NOT apply topical creams or oils to the scales.** These can clog pores and cause skin infections.
- **Do NOT give human calcium supplements without veterinary guidance.** They often contain the wrong type of calcium and may have additives that are toxic to reptiles.
- **Do NOT assume that just because the lizard is eating, it is getting enough calcium.** The diet may be high in phosphorus, which is actively preventing calcium absorption.

## Prognosis and Long-Term Management

The prognosis for a bearded dragon with pyramiding depends on the severity of the condition and the owner's commitment to correcting the husbandry. If the condition is caught early and the underlying causes are fixed, the dragon can live a long and comfortable life, despite the permanent cosmetic bumps. If the disease is advanced, with severe bone deformities and fractures, the prognosis is guarded to poor, and euthanasia may be the most humane option if the animal is in unmanageable pain.

Long-term management is a lifelong commitment to proper husbandry. This means:
- Regularly checking and replacing UVB bulbs.
- Providing a balanced diet.
- Maintaining correct temperatures.
- Scheduling annual veterinary check-ups, which are essential for preventive care.

## Prevention: The Best Treatment

Preventing pyramiding is far easier than treating it. The key is to replicate the natural environment of the bearded dragon as closely as possible.

1.  **Invest in High-Quality UVB Lighting:** This is non-negotiable. A linear fluorescent or mercury vapor bulb specifically designed for desert reptiles is required.
2.  **Provide a Proper Thermal Gradient:** Use a thermostat to regulate temperatures.
3.  **Feed a Balanced Diet:** Offer a variety of insects and vegetables. Dust insects with a calcium supplement at most feedings and a multivitamin supplement once or twice a week.
4.  **Ensure Proper Hydration:** Provide a shallow water dish and mist the lizard regularly, although they get most of their water from their food.
5.  **Regular Veterinary Check-ups:** Annual exams with bloodwork can catch subclinical problems before they become visible diseases.

## Frequently Asked Questions

### What exactly causes pyramiding in bearded dragons?
Pyramiding is caused by a chronic deficiency of calcium and vitamin D3, leading to metabolic bone disease. The most common cause is inadequate UVB lighting, which prevents the lizard from synthesizing vitamin D3 needed to absorb calcium. A diet high in phosphorus and low in calcium also contributes significantly.

### Can pyramiding be reversed or cured?
No, pyramiding cannot be reversed. The physical bumps are permanent changes to the skin and underlying bone. However, with immediate and correct veterinary treatment and husbandry correction, the progression of the disease can be halted, allowing the dragon to live a comfortable life.

### Is pyramiding painful for my bearded dragon?
Yes, pyramiding is a sign of metabolic bone disease, which is a painful condition. It causes bone pain, muscle weakness, and can lead to fractures. If you suspect your dragon has this condition, prompt veterinary care is essential to manage pain and improve its quality of life.

### How much UVB light does a bearded dragon need to prevent pyramiding?
Bearded dragons need a high-output UVB bulb specifically designed for desert reptiles. The bulb should be on for 10-12 hours a day and placed at the correct distance (typically 6-12 inches) from the basking spot, with no glass or plastic blocking the rays. Bulbs lose potency and should be replaced every 6-12 months.

### What is the ideal calcium-to-phosphorus ratio in a bearded dragon's diet?
The ideal calcium-to-phosphorus ratio is between 1.5:1 and 2:1. Many feeder insects have a poor ratio, being high in phosphorus. To correct this, insects should be "gut-loaded" with nutritious food and dusted with a calcium supplement before feeding them to your dragon.

### My bearded dragon is eating well. Why does it still have pyramiding?
Eating well does not mean the dragon is absorbing nutrients properly. If the UVB lighting is inadequate, it cannot absorb calcium from its food, no matter how much it eats. Also, if the diet consists of high-phosphorus insects, the phosphorus will bind to the calcium in the gut and prevent its absorption, leading to deficiency despite a good appetite.

### Why is my veterinarian checking blood glucose and bile acids for a shell problem?
Pyramiding is a sign of systemic metabolic disease. Your veterinarian will run a full blood panel to assess the function of organs like the liver and kidneys, which are critical for calcium and vitamin D metabolism. Recent studies show that blood glucose, bile acids, and uric acid levels change significantly after eating, so your vet will interpret these results based on your dragon's feeding history [<a href="#ref-2">2</a>].

### What should I do if I suspect my bearded dragon has pyramiding?
You should schedule an appointment with a veterinarian who specializes in reptiles as soon as possible. While waiting for the appointment, you can review your husbandry, especially your UVB bulb's age and placement, and ensure the temperature gradient is correct. Do not attempt to treat the condition yourself without a diagnosis.
